[0057] Embodiment one: if Figure 4 and Figure 6 As shown, a method for setting parameters of an ECM motor that replaces an outdoor PSC motor, the ECM motor has a stator assembly, a rotor assembly, a casing assembly and a motor controller, and the motor controller includes a power circuit, a microprocessor , inverter circuit and voltage measurement circuit, the voltage measurement circuit measures the AC input voltage Vac of the external input power supply, the power supply circuit supplies power to each part of the circuit, the voltage measurement circuit inputs the measured voltage signal into the microprocessor, and the microprocessor controls the drive of the inverter circuit Stator assembly, is characterized in that: it comprises the steps:

[0058] Step 1) Power on the motor and detect the AC input voltage Vac;

The invention relates to an ECM motor parameter setting method for replacing a PSC motor. The motor is powered on and detects the DC bus voltage Vdc or the AC input voltage Vac; if the DC bus voltage Vdc or the AC input voltage Vac is greater than a certain set value, the motor According to the normal working state of the motor; if the DC bus voltage Vdc or the AC input voltage Vac is less than a certain set value, enter the steering speed programming state; there are 4 programming states, programming state 1: set the steering to CW, set the speed to Set to H; programming state 2: set the steering to CW, set the speed to L; programming state 3: set the steering to CCW, set the speed to L; programming state 4: set the steering to CCW, set the speed to Set it to H; if the user turns off the power in a certain programming state, it means that the user thinks the state is suitable, and the steering data and speed data corresponding to the programming state are stored and recorded as the normal operation parameters of the motor; on-site debugging is very simple and convenient, which is beneficial to ECM A wide range of motor applications.

technical field [0001] The invention relates to a parameter setting method of an ECM motor replacing a PSC motor. Background technique [0002] refer to figure 1 , showing a fixed speed PSC motor used in a residential HVAC (heating ventilation and air conditioning system) system. figure 1 Take an indoor unit load as an example, but this patent is also applicable to the application of outdoor units. The motor has four winding gear taps to demodulate two heating fan speeds and two cooling fan speeds. Fan speed is controlled by the furnace control board, which is equipped with cooling / heating relays, low / high cooling relays, and low / high heating relays. Other HVAC systems include two heating stages and a single cooling stage, or some other combination of heating and cooling speeds.
